Full Cast Announced for Jenny Schwartz and Todd Almond's Iowa

Lee Sellars, Jill Shackner, Kolette Tetlow, and more to star in the musical play at Playwrights Horizons.

Playwrights Horizons has announced casting for Iowa, the world premiere of a new musical play written by Jenny Schwartz with music by Todd Almond and lyrics by Almond and Schwartz. Ken Rus Schmoll directs the production, which will begin previews on March 20 with an opening night set for April 13 at Playwrights Horizons’ Peter Jay Sharp Theater.

The full cast of Iowa will feature Cindy Cheung, April Matthis, Annie McNamara, Karyn Quackenbush, Carolina Sanchez, Lee Sellars, Jill Shackner, and Kolette Tetlow.

In Iowa, "Mom found her soul-mate on Facebook, and he lives in Iowa. So Becca says goodbye to her beloved math teacher, bulimic best friend, neighborhood pony, and her mildly deficient teenage life, and she follows her wayward mother to a new, uncharted beginning."

The production will feature scenic design by Dane Laffrey, costume design by Arnulfo Maldonado, lighting design by Tyler Micoleau, and sound design by Daniel Kluger. Musical direction will be by J. Oconer Navarro.
